< All Topics
Print

¿Cómo controlar el rendimiento de la base de datos en sql server?

Para supervisar el rendimiento de la base de datos en SQL Server, puedes utilizar varias herramientas y técnicas. Una de las formas más comunes es utilizar las características y funcionalidades incorporadas que proporciona el propio SQL Server. SQL Server Management Studio (SSMS) ofrece varias herramientas de supervisión del rendimiento que pueden ayudarte a controlar el rendimiento de tu base de datos. Estas herramientas incluyen el Monitor de Actividad, el Perfilador del Servidor SQL y el Asesor de Ajuste del Motor de Base de Datos.

El Monitor de Actividad es una herramienta de SSMS que proporciona una visión gráfica de los distintos procesos y actividades que tienen lugar en tu instancia de SQL Server. Te permite controlar el uso de recursos, los procesos activos y otras métricas de rendimiento importantes en tiempo real. Utilizando el Monitor de Actividad, puedes identificar rápidamente cualquier cuello de botella o problema de rendimiento que pueda estar afectando al rendimiento de tu base de datos.

SQL Server Profiler es otra potente herramienta que te permite capturar y analizar los eventos que se producen en tu instancia de SQL Server. Puedes utilizar el Perfilador de SQL Server para realizar un seguimiento de los tiempos de ejecución de las consultas, identificar las que funcionan con lentitud y analizar el rendimiento de tu servidor de bases de datos. Al capturar y analizar estos eventos, puedes obtener información valiosa sobre el rendimiento de tu base de datos e identificar áreas de mejora.

Database Engine Tuning Advisor es una herramienta que te ayuda a optimizar el rendimiento de tu instancia de SQL Server recomendándote estrategias de optimización de índices, particiones y consultas. Puedes utilizar el Asesor de Ajuste del Motor de Base de Datos para analizar la carga de trabajo de tu servidor de base de datos y generar recomendaciones para mejorar el rendimiento. Poniendo en práctica las recomendaciones proporcionadas por el Asesor de ajuste del motor de base de datos, puedes optimizar el rendimiento de tu base de datos y asegurarte de que funciona con eficacia.

Además de estas herramientas integradas, también puedes utilizar herramientas de supervisión de terceros para seguir y controlar el rendimiento de tus bases de datos SQL Server. Estas herramientas ofrecen características y funcionalidades avanzadas que pueden ayudarte a conocer mejor el rendimiento de tu base de datos e identificar posibles problemas. Algunas herramientas de supervisión de terceros populares para SQL Server son SQL Diagnostic Manager, SolarWinds Database Performance Analyzer y Quest Foglight for Databases.

Al supervisar el rendimiento de la base de datos en SQL Server, es importante centrarse en las métricas de rendimiento clave, como el uso de la CPU, el uso de la memoria, la E/S del disco y los tiempos de ejecución de las consultas. Si realizas un seguimiento regular de estas métricas y analizas los datos, podrás identificar los cuellos de botella en el rendimiento, optimizar tu servidor de bases de datos y asegurarte de que tus aplicaciones funcionan sin problemas.

En general, supervisar el rendimiento de las bases de datos en SQL Server es esencial para mantener la salud y la eficacia de tus bases de datos. Utilizando las herramientas y técnicas adecuadas, puedes identificar y abordar proactivamente los problemas de rendimiento, optimizar tu servidor de bases de datos y garantizar que tus aplicaciones rinden al máximo.

Table of Contents